• Home
  • About
    • 황우진 블로그 photo

      황우진 블로그

      경희대학교 컴퓨터공학과 재학중

    • Learn More
    • Email
    • Github
  • Posts
    • All Posts
    • All Tags
  • Projects

블로그를 만들고 배포하는 정말 쉬운 방법 : Moon 테마로 Jekyll 블로그 만들고 Github 에 배포하기

28 Dec 2019

Reading time ~1 minute

Jekyll 과 Github pages 를 이용해서 쉽고 간단하게 블로그를 만들 수 있습니다.

Moon 은 약 2천개의 Github Star 를 받은 인기있는 Jekyll 테마입니다.

이 테마를 가져와서 개인 블로그를 만들어 보도록 하겠습니다.

먼저 해당 Github 리포지토리로 이동합니다.

TaylanTatli/Moon

fork 를 통해 해당 코드를 나의 리포지토리로 가져옵니다.

그러면 다음과 같이 나의 리포지토리에 Moon 리포지토리가 생성됩니다.

리포지토리 이름을 다음과 같이 바꾸어줍니다.

[Github username].github.io

저같은 경우 username 은 woojin-hwang 입니다. 그래서 woojin-hwang.github.io 로 변경했습니다.

그러면 Github pages 가 자동으로 생성이 됩니다.

이제 블로그의 정보를 수정하겠습니다.

먼저 블로그의 타이틀, 바이오를 수정하겠습니다.

_config.yml 파일의 다음 부분을 수정해야 합니다.

title:              Moon
bio:                'Minimal, one column jekyll theme.'

title 과 bio 는 블로그 첫 화면에 나타나는 정보를 나타냅니다.

전 다음과 같이 수정하도록 하겠습니다.

title:              황우진 블로그
bio:                '경희대학교 재학중'

또 아래의 Social 정보를 수정해야 합니다.

twitter:            username
facebook:           username
github-url:         username
...

username 이라고 입력된 곳에 해당 서비스의 사용자 아이디를 입력합니다.

사용하지 않는 경우 주석처리를 하면 블로그 첫 화면에서 사라집니다.

이를 다음과 같이 수정하도록 하겠습니다.

...
# 필요없는 것은 주석 처리
email:              woojinhwang@khu.ac.kr
github-url:         woojin-hwang
...

그러면 다음과 같이 개인화된 첫 화면을 얻을 수 있습니다.

글 작성은 Markdown 문법을 사용하면 되겠습니다.

About 은 about 폴더에 생성합니다.

Posts 는 _posts 폴더에 layout을 지켜서 생성합니다.

Project 는 Posts 와 동일하지만, 상단에 project:true 를 추가합니다.

더 자세한 정보는 Setup Guide 를 참조하시기 바랍니다.



moonjekyllgithub-pages Share Tweet +1